How do long sentences engage the reader?

Good writing consists of a mixture of short and long sentences. Short sentences have punch and are a great way to emphasize important points. Longer sentences add rhythm to your writing. By using both short and long sentences, you add interest and drama to your writing that keeps your readers’ attention.

How do long sentences affect the tone?

Changing up the number of words in a sentence affects the way a piece is read. It creates cadence and rhythm. Sentence fluency is all about how the writing sounds. Determining the number of words for each sentence provides the undercurrent for the tone and message.

How does long sentences create tension?

Long sentences – (1) writers create a list of fearful or worrying details, which creates an overwhelming, claustrophobic or intense feeling. (2) Writers build suspense by leaving the most shocking thing to the end of a long sentence. This can be particularly shocking after a long sentence.

What is the effect of a short sentence?

What is the effect of a short sentence? Think of the importance of sentence structure – short, simple sentences or truncated sentences can create tension, haste or urgency, whereas longer compound or complex sentences are slower, and often feature in formal texts.

What is the effect of long complex sentences?

Using complex sentences can make it easier to add layers of information and detail when writing. Complex sentences have at least one subordinate clause that adds more detail and information to the sentence.

Are long sentences OK?

Even writers who opt to aim for an average sentence length of, e.g., 20 to 25 words should mix long and short sentences to keep their reader’s interest. Long sentences work best when your reader’s interest is piqued, as these sentences have the advantage of flow but require more focus on the part of the reader.
